On behalf of our client, a private bank in the Geneva area, we are looking for an Investment Funds – Senior Corporate Actions Specialist to strengthen their teams in Geneva.
You will join the Back Office Operations department and become part of a team specialised in processing securities operations related to investment funds. You will ensure the quality, reliability, and compliance of operations, while maintaining close collaboration with internal teams and custodian banks.
This position is to be filled on a temporary contract basis for one year, full-time.
Main Responsibilities
- Process and analyse securities events received via SWIFT, mail, and Telekurs.
- Manage securities operations and coupons related to investment funds.
- Provide accurate and timely notifications to Client Relationship Officers.
- Reconcile cash and securities positions for all files.
- Process instructions related to voluntary operations and forward them to custodian banks.
- Correctly record securities operations in the banking system.
- Monitor and resolve incidents or queries related to securities operations.
- Respond to requests from internal teams and custodian banks.
- Perform daily controls and administrative tasks necessary for the smooth running of the activity.
- Ensure the integrity, reliability, and compliance of operational processes.
- Participate in the continuous improvement of working methods and internal procedures.
